从MQL4向Node.js发送多个时间帧数据,可以通过以下步骤实现:
- 在MQL4中,使用MQL4的网络库或自定义的网络通信库,将多个时间帧数据打包成一个数据包。数据包可以是JSON格式或其他自定义格式。
- 在MQL4中,使用网络库的API,将打包好的数据包发送到Node.js服务器。可以使用HTTP协议或自定义的协议进行数据传输。
- 在Node.js服务器端,使用相应的网络库或框架,接收MQL4发送的数据包。
- 在Node.js服务器端,解析接收到的数据包,提取多个时间帧数据。
- 在Node.js服务器端,根据业务需求对接收到的时间帧数据进行处理和分析。
- 如果需要将处理后的数据返回给MQL4,可以使用相同的网络通信方式,将数据打包成数据包发送回MQL4。
在这个过程中,可以使用以下腾讯云产品来支持云计算和网络通信的需求:
- 云服务器(CVM):提供稳定可靠的云服务器实例,用于部署Node.js服务器。
- 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,用于存储和管理数据。
- 云函数(SCF):无服务器计算服务,用于处理和分析接收到的时间帧数据。
- 云网络(VPC):提供安全可靠的网络环境,用于构建MQL4和Node.js服务器之间的网络通信。
- 云监控(Cloud Monitor):实时监控和管理云资源的性能和运行状态,保证系统的稳定性和可靠性。
请注意,以上仅为示例,具体的产品选择和配置应根据实际需求进行。